<p dir="auto">You mentioned Jung's shadow and the brain's threat detection, which is spot on, but let me layer on a bit from the lab-rat side of my brain. I haven't fully shaken off the molecular biology training, even if I'm trading pipettes for palm readings now. There's a framework in neuroscience called predictive coding, heavily associated with <a href="https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Karl_Friston" rel="nofollow ugc">Karl Friston</a> and the Free Energy Principle. The core idea is that your brain is a prediction machine. It generates a model of the world and updates it based on sensory errors. When you start tuning into "presences" or static that defies your existing categories, you're generating massive prediction errors. Your brain can't file the data, so it flags the input as a high-priority threat. That cold spine? That's your neural architecture throwing a fit because the signal breaks the model. It's not just the collective shadow rising; it's your cortex trying to debug reality and failing. The terror is the friction of your ego's operating system crashing against a data set it wasn't built to handle.</p>
